The London Ambient Orchestra are a community of improvisers and artists reflective of London’s rich cultural diversity. The collective features conservatory educated classical musicians together with members of Penguin Cafe Orchestra and collaborators with Lubomyr Melnyk & Tony Visconti, this is an orchestra but not as you know it… The LAO is an electroacoustic melange where classical instruments stand side by side with pedal
steel guitar, samplers and loops.

Born out of extended jams in back rooms of music conservatories and hidden DIY studio spaces in east London, the LAO has gone on to numerous accolades including: stand out sets at Wilderness Festival, a sell out show at London’s Stone Nest, collaborations with Erased Tapes artist Douglas Dare. As well as gaining the support of ambient music legend William Basinski.

The music of the LAO is a meditative and exploratory space for stillness, beauty and equanimity.
